Abstract:
Under the current situation that the load types and capacity of distribution network are also increasing, in order to solve the problem of serious low-voltage problem of distribution network in remote areas, and the lack of targeted and fundamental analysis methods and treatment measures, this paper proposes a low-voltage treatment method of distribution network considering the load accumulation effect. Through on-site experimental testing and theoretical analysis, the essential causes of low voltage problems were analyzed, and the concepts of load accumulation effect and unit voltage discount rate were put forward. Based on this, the voltage control measures were put forward. The simulation results show that the control measures proposed based on this research method can effectively solve the problem of low voltage of distribution lines, and the voltage of the whole line can meet the requirements of power supply voltage deviations. The proposed research method can accurately formulate low-voltage control measures, with significant effect, and can save a lot of costs, which has practical guiding significance, and can be widely used in the improvement of power quality in distribution network.
